Technical Lead Resume
ChicagO
SUMMARY
- Over 13+ years of experience analysis, design, Development, testing and implement high quality software applications.
- Worked as a Senior Consultant with major focus on Finance, Health care, Medical Device and Semiconductor domain
- Expertise in Object Oriented Analysis, Design, Development and Testing of Software Applications Primarily using C#.net
- Expertiseinarchitect,design, development and implementation of Web Applications across windows platform
- Experience in developing object oriented programming, and developing applications built with services oriented architecture (SOA).
- Expertisein developing web and windows based solutions using technologies such as ASP.NET, ASP.NET MVC, and C #, VB.NET, ADO.NET, WCF, Ajax, Java script, JQuery, TFS, XSL and XML
- Expertisein OLE - DB, ODBC and ADO to connect SQL Server database with application
- Experience in Crystal Reports
- Expertisein multi-tier design, development and implementation of Client/Server Applications, Remoting, Web Services and Messaging across.NetFramework
- ExperienceinXML related technologies such asXML, XSLT, DTD,XML Schema and DOM
- ExtensiveExperience in all phases ofSoftwareDevelopment Life Cycle(Planning, Analysis, Design, Implementation, Testing and Deployment)and Detail Design process
- Expertisein Object Oriented Analysis and Design (OOAD/OOD),Process improvement and documentation
- Used Agile Methodology for Development
- Used Design patters such as Factory pattern, Singleton and Inversion of Control
- Sound management skills, capable of leading & motivating individuals to maximize levels of productivity
- Problem solver with a passion for technology, skilled in conceptualizing, developing, implementing solutions & partnering closely with business leaders & stakeholders
- A customer-centric professional as well as a knack for motivating and guiding large workforces for exceeding customer expectations in delivery of committed services
TECHNICAL SKILLS
Programming Languages: C#, VB.Net,VB, PL/SQL, HTML, XML, C, VC++
Scripting Languages: JavaScript, VBScript, Jquey, JSON
Architectures/Design patterns: Client/Server, Distributed Systems, MVC3,MVC4,RESTWBAPI,MVP,DependencyInjection/IOC, Factory patterns.
Web Technologies and Windows: ASP.Net, ASP.Net.MVC3, MVC4, MVC5ASP, HTML, XML, XSL,SOAP, JavaScript, Jquery, LinQ, WinForms, webforms.
Tools: &Utilities: Rational Rose, Clear Case,TFS,VSS, Clearquest, NUnit, FxCOPE, MS Project, MS Office, MS Visio,RationalRose Visual Studio Team Test,UnityApplicationBlocks,Git
Reporting Tools: Crystal Reports, SSRS
Databases: SQL Server 2000/2005/2008
Operating Systems: Windows 95/98, Win 2K, Win XP/Vista, DOS.
Application Servers: Microsoft IIS 5.0/6.0/7.0
PROFESSIONAL EXPERIENCE
Confidential, Chicago
Technical Lead
Responsibilities:
- Invoved in design, coding, corroborating with Solution Architect
- Involved in designing Windows services
- Business layer development responsibility: Was involved in the development of the controller classes the model classes .
- Implemented test cases using VSTS
- Used ReSharper for code inspection and code Refactoring
- Used LINQ for querying the data from the collections
- Used Agile methodology for development and VSTS for unit testing of the components.
Environment: .Net 4.5 a, C#, WCF, MVC5. Entity Frame Work JSON, Sqlserver2012, Visual Studio Team Test
Confidential, Houston, Texas
Technical Lead
Responsibilities:
- Business layer/UI development responsibility: Was involved in the development of the View controller and the model classes .
- Involved in designing and development of WCF services
- Implemented test cases using VSTS
- Used ReSharper for code inspection and code Refactoring
Environment: .Net 4.0, C#, WCF, ASP.Net,MVC4, JavaScript,Jquery,JSON, Oracle,Visual Studio Team Test
Confidential, Charlotte, NC
.Net Developer
Responsibilities:
- Invoved in design, coding, corroborating with Solution Architect
- Involved in designing and development of RESTI services and Windows services
- Business layer development responsibility: Was involved in the development of the controller classes, the model classes .
- Implement agile scrum methodology in application development.
- Implemented test cases using VSTS
- Used ReSharper for code inspection and code Refactoring
- Used LINQ for querying the data from the collections
- Used Agile methodology for development and VSTS for unit testing of the components.
Environment: .Net 4.5 a, C#, WCF, REST API, JSON, Sqlserver2012,Visual Studio Team Test
Confidential, California
Senior Consultant
Responsibilities:
- I was involved in architecture design, coding, corroborating with Business Analyst, and leading the development team.
- Translated exiting Use Cases, sequence diagrams and implementing it as per specifications.
- Involved in designing and development of SOA services using WCF .
- Database base layer responsibility: Developed different database objects for various business functionalities in SQL Server.
Environment: .Net 4.5,C#, WCF, SQL 2012, XML, ASP.Net MVC4, Jquery, javacript,JSON, EntityFramework,, Visual Studio Team Test
Confidential
.Net Technical Leader
Responsibilities:
- Created Data Model, design Data Tier and Service Integration Tier.
- Used multi-threading to boost performance and responsiveness of applications
- Involved in Code reviews and used FxCope to do the code Analysis.
Environment: .Net 3.5 and Winforms, C#, WCF, ASP.Net MVC, EntityFramework, Jquery,javacript,JSON, SQL 2005, XML
Confidential
Senior .Net Developer
Responsibilities:
- Interacting with Customer and understand their requirement and generate requirements as per the business needs
- Translated exiting Use Cases, sequence diagrams and implementing it as per specifications.
- Assisted my superiors to design secure and optimized Architecture and recommending solution
- Used TDD methodology for development and VSTS for unit testing of the components
- Created complex Queries related to joining tables and aggregation of data
Environment: .Net 3.5, C#, WInForms, WebService, SQL 2005
Confidential
.Net Project Lead
Responsibilities:
- Guide high level and low level design Responsible for leading a project team in delivering solution to the customer.
- Implemented business rules and user interfaces using ASP.NET, C#, AJAX and JavaScript.
- Designed and developed windows service using C#
Environment: ASP.Net, Visual Studio .Net 2005, Ajax, Ado.net, Javascript
Confidential
Project Lead
Responsibilities:
- Collected business requirements from users and translated them as technical specs and design docs for development.
- Was responsible for the design and development of based on the given specs and requirements.
- Independently perform and guide, assist or mentor others in software coding, testing, debugging, documentation, and installation tasks.
- Responsible for managing scope, planning, tracking, change control, aspects of the project.
- Responsible for effective communication between the project team and the customer.
- Provide day to day direction to the project team and regular project status to the customer.
Environment: Visual Studio .Net 2005, C#, Win Forms, SQL 2005
Confidential
Project Lead
Responsibilities:
- Collected business requirements from users and translated them as technical specs and design docs for development.
- Was responsible for the design and development of based on the given specs and requirements.
- Responsible for low level design, coding, problem solving and customer interaction
- Involved in Team building activities and mentoring.
Environment: Visual Studio .Net 2005, C#, ASP.net, SQL 2005
Confidential
Senior .Net Developer
Responsibilities:
- Documented the existing Product.
- Involved in Change request implementation
- Technical support for the Product.
Environment: Visual Studio .Net 2003, C#, ASP.Net, SQL 2005
Confidential
.Net Developer
Responsibilities:
- Creating Code Components, Implementing business rules in the code using C#
- Involved in implementation of change request and unit testing
Environment: Visual Studio .Net 2003, C#, Win Forms, SQL 2005
Confidential
Software Developer
Responsibilities:
- Was involved in the complete Software Life Cycle of the project
- Involved in Unit and Integration testing
Environment: ASP, SQL Server, VB Script, and Java Script.
